Rappaport Name Meaning
Jewish (Ashkenazic): most people bearing this name are descended from Avrom-Menakhem Ben-Yankev Hakoyen Rapa, who lived in Porto, Italy, at the beginning of the 16th century. The etymology of his name is uncertain but possibly from German Rappe ‘raven’. Compare Rapp. According to one explanation his descendants added the name of their city, Porto, in order to distinguish themselves from unrelated Jews surnamed Rapa; according to another, there was a marriage between the Rapa and Porto families, and the issue of this union took the compound name.
Source: Dictionary of American Family Names ©2013, Oxford University Press
